My Thoughts on Sleep Position
My sleeping position plays a huge role in what pillow I choose. If I sleep on my side, I need more height and support. If I sleep on my back, I usually prefer medium support. If I sleep on my stomach, I need something softer and lower. I would only buy the Carpenter Sleep Better Pillow if it matched the way I actually sleep.
